Rainwater Harvesting Systems offers an environmentally focused plumbing service that entails the design and installation of systems to collect, store, and reuse rainwater for secondary applications. These systems typically feature storage tanks, catchment areas, and filters, enabling sustainable water use in irrigation, flushing, and cleaning. Properly configured systems help cut expenses and support environmental sustainability
